Brush and manure pile fire damages utility pole, Boyertown PA


Fire crews responded to a fire contained to a brush and manure pile near Reading Avenue. The fire did not spread to nearby woods. A fallen tree damaged electrical wires and a telephone pole with a transformer, creating a hazard in the area.
